Mangrove Forests

Mangrove forests, also known as mangrove swamps or mangals, are dense forests found in coastal saline or brackish water environments in tropical and subtropical intertidal zones. These unique ecosystems are characterized by the presence of mangrove trees, which are specially adapted to thrive in the challenging conditions of saltwater inundation and anoxic soils.

Ecology and Adaptations

Mangrove forests play a crucial role in coastal ecology. They serve as breeding grounds and nurseries for numerous marine species, including fishes, crustaceans, and mollusks. The dense root systems of mangrove trees stabilize shorelines, reducing erosion caused by wave action and storm surges. These roots also trap sediments, improving water clarity and quality.

Mangroves are uniquely adapted to their environment. For instance, species like the red mangrove (Rhizophora mangle) develop prop roots that provide structural support and gas exchange. Other species, such as the black mangrove (Avicennia germinans), possess pneumatophores, which are specialized aerial roots that facilitate oxygen intake.

Global Distribution

Mangrove forests are distributed globally between the 5° N and 5° S latitudes, with the largest concentrations found in countries like Indonesia, Brazil, and Australia. In India, significant mangrove ecosystems include the Sundarbans, a UNESCO World Heritage Site, and the Pichavaram mangroves.

In the United States, Florida is home to prominent mangrove forests, which include three main species: the red mangrove, the black mangrove, and the white mangrove (Laguncularia racemosa). These forests are crucial for protecting coastal regions from hurricanes and providing habitat for wildlife.

Importance and Threats

Mangrove forests are vital for carbon sequestration, acting as significant carbon sinks that mitigate climate change. They also support local communities by providing resources such as timber, fish, and honey.

However, mangrove ecosystems face numerous threats. Human activities, including coastal development, aquaculture, and pollution, have led to the degradation and loss of mangrove habitats. Efforts in mangrove restoration are underway in many regions to combat these threats and restore these vital ecosystems.

Notable Mangrove Ecosystems

  1. Sundarbans: Spanning the India-Bangladesh border, the Sundarbans is the largest mangrove forest in the world, known for its biodiversity, including the Bengal tiger.
  2. Niger Delta Mangroves: Located in Nigeria, these mangroves are among the most extensive in Africa, playing a crucial role in regional ecology and economy.
  3. Australian Mangroves: While comprising less than 1% of Australia's total forest area, these mangroves are essential for maintaining coastal biodiversity.
